Private TRYLUS PROBETTS

Service Number: 21477
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Durham Light Infantry

25th Bn.

Date of Death

Died 20 February 1919

Age 33 years old

Buried or commemorated at

WANDSWORTH (EARLSFIELD) CEMETERY

Screen Wall. G.B. 18. 147.

United Kingdom

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Secondary Unit, Regiment transf. to (456295) 426th Agricultural Coy. Labour Corps
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Son of the late William and Mary Ann Probetts, of Wandsworth, London.
